What they do
A Psychiatrist diagnoses and treats patients dealing with mental illness. Assesses and treats the mental and physical aspects of psychological problems. Trained and licensed as a physician, and writes prescriptions for patients. Works in clinical settings including hospitals, private practice offices and community health programs.

LiveWell Homecare Agency Trenton, NJ Job Details Full-time 1 day ago Benefits Health insurance Paid time off Flexible schedule Retirement plan Qualifications Doctoral degree Psychiatry Maintaining patient confidentiality Medical License Patient interaction Full Job Description We are seeking a Staff Psychiatrist to provide comprehensive psychiatric care in a top-rated residential addiction treatment program. Responsibilities include conducting assessments, diagnosing mental health disorders, developing treatment plans, managing medications, and providing psychotherapy. The psychiatrist collaborates with a multidisciplinary team, ensures regulatory compliance, and participates in quality improvement initiatives. Qualifications required are medical degree, psychiatric residency completion, board certification, state licensure, and subspecialty or experience in addiction psychiatry. Skills include mental health expertise, compassionate communication, teamwork, and adherence to confidentiality and legal standards. Physical demands involve mobility, communication, and light lifting. Benefits offered include health insurance, retirement plans, paid time off, and flexible schedules. This is an in-person role requiring availability for occasional on-call, weekends, or holidays.Benefits
